Abstract PO-078: Clinical characteristics and outcomes of cancer patients with COVID-19 infection: A retrospective study in a single center in the Philippines

Abstract: Background: The COVID-19 pandemic is a rapidly evolving crisis worldwide. Cancer patients represent a highly vulnerable group during this pandemic and are facing the most severe and critical consequences of this outbreak. To date, the data on clinical characteristics and outcomes of COVID-19 infected are largely unknown and limited to case reports and small cohorts.
